The Commons Home Affairs Select Committee (per articles in press) condemned plan for biometric cards - containing information such as fingerprints and iris scans as "improperly costed, poorly thought out and too secretive!"
Mr Davies - who gave evidence to this committee - said "There are too many ways that this system can be by-passed. It cannot be made water tight and will not catch the very folk it is meant to catch!
